Assisting Our Neighbor's Place

Bob delivered clothing to EUMA for the Our Neighbor's Place seasonal overflow shelter. Our Neighbor's Place offers guests a warm and safe place to sleep during the winter months. In addition, the shelter provides food, an opportunity to shower, hygiene necessities, and other services.

Bringing some Girl Scout cookies to the Mercy Center for Women

Dave stopped by the Mercy Center for Women with a special delivery—some Girl Scouts cookies and other essentials for the residents they serve. The Mercy Center for Women provides safe, supportive, and empowering housing solutions for families in transition, with a focus on those affected by domestic violence, addiction, and mental health challenges.

Fostering a love of reading

As part of our continued support for students as they return to the classrooms, Shahad purchased 50 books at Werner Books. These books will be awarded to kids through the WQLN PBS Q-Kids Readers program. This fun initiative encourages kids to discover the joys of reading. Each month, kids in the program track the time they spent reading or having someone else read to them. By supporting kids in their reading adventures, the program hopes to improve their literacy while developing a lifelong love of reading.

Hunger Action Month

September is Hunger Action Month. When we saw our locally owned Donatos Pizza franchise was donating part of their proceeds to the Second Harvest Food Bank of Northwest Pennsylvania on Tuesday, well, it became pizza day at the office! Hunger Action Month is a Feeding America national campaign to raise awareness and to help bring an end to hunger in our communities.
